Output 3042d3e74db0ac9b3437af1458dd43f2387b9160c8f967d4bc86b2e183eeda13:2

value
103629396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faa44f540c6eb4c85c31c7725ff223dd340d6d69 OP_EQUAL
address
3QYHgx9nKiiRpG7vxuoqrtpaWyCzwPP34d
transaction
3042d3e74db0ac9b3437af1458dd43f2387b9160c8f967d4bc86b2e183eeda13
confirmations
291525
spent
true